FontInfo
Содержание
[
Скрывать
]
FontInfo class
Указывает информацию о шрифте, используемом в документе.
public class FontInfo
Характеристики
Имя | Описание |
---|---|
AltName { get; set; } | Получает или задает альтернативное имя шрифта. |
Charset { get; set; } | Получает или задает набор символов для шрифта. |
Family { get; set; } | Получает или задает семейство шрифтов, к которому принадлежит этот шрифт. |
IsTrueType { get; set; } | Указывает, что данный шрифт является шрифтом TrueType или OpenType, а не растровым или векторным шрифтом. Значение по умолчанию — true. |
Name { get; } | Получает имя шрифта. |
Panose { get; set; } | Получает или задает классификационный номер гарнитуры шрифта PANOSE. |
Pitch { get; set; } | Шаг указывает, является ли шрифт фиксированным шагом, пропорциональным интервалом или зависит от настройки по умолчанию. |
Методы
Имя | Описание |
---|---|
GetEmbeddedFont(EmbeddedFontFormat, EmbeddedFontStyle) | Получает определенный встроенный файл шрифта. |
GetEmbeddedFontAsOpenType(EmbeddedFontStyle) | Получает встроенный файл шрифта в формате OpenType. Шрифты в формате Embedded OpenType конвертируются в OpenType. |
Примечания
Вы не создаете экземпляры этого класса напрямую. ИспользуйтеFontInfos
для доступа к коллекции шрифтов , определенных в документе.
Примеры
Показывает, как напечатать сведения о том, какие шрифты присутствуют в документе.
Document doc = new Document(MyDir + "Embedded font.docx");
FontInfoCollection allFonts = doc.FontInfos;
// Печатаем все используемые и неиспользуемые шрифты в документе.
for (int i = 0; i < allFonts.Count; i++)
{
Console.WriteLine($"Font index #{i}");
Console.WriteLine($"\tName: {allFonts[i].Name}");
Console.WriteLine($"\tIs {(allFonts[i].IsTrueType ? "" : "not ")}a trueType font");
}
Смотрите также
- пространство имен Aspose.Words.Fonts
- сборка Aspose.Words